                                LEGISLATURE OF NEBRASKA
                          ONE HUNDRED EIGHTH LEGISLATURE
                                    FIRST SESSION
                       LEGISLATIVE BILL 221
        Introduced by Ibach, 44.
        Read first time January 10, 2023
        Committee: Nebraska Retirement Systems
 1      A BILL FOR AN ACT relating to retirement; to amend section 16-1021,
  2         Reissue Revised Statutes of Nebraska; to redefine a term relating to
 3          all firefighters of a city of the first class; and to repeal the
 4          original section.
 5      Be it enacted by the people of the State of Nebraska,

 1            Section 1. Section 16-1021, Reissue Revised Statutes of Nebraska, is
 2      amended to read:
 3            16-1021 For the purposes of sections 16-1020 to 16-1042, unless the
 4      context otherwise requires:
 5            (1) Actuarial equivalent means equality in value of the aggregate
 6      amount of benefit expected to be received under different forms or at
 7      different times determined as of a given date as adopted by the city or
 8      the retirement committee for use by the retirement system. Actuarial
 9      equivalencies shall be specified in the funding medium established for
10      the retirement system,   except that if   benefits under the retirement
11      system are obtained through the purchase of an annuity contract, the
12      actuarial equivalency of any such form of benefit shall be the amount of
13      pension benefit which can be purchased or otherwise provided by such
14      contract. All actuarial and mortality assumptions adopted by the city or
15      retirement committee shall be on a sex-neutral basis;
16            (2) Annuity contract means the contract or contracts issued by one
17      or more life insurance companies or designated trusts and purchased by
18      the retirement system in order to provide any of the benefits described
19      in such sections. Annuity conversion rates contained in any such contract
20      shall be specified on a sex-neutral basis;
21            (3)   Beneficiary means the person or   persons designated by   a
22      firefighter, pursuant to a written instrument filed with the retirement
23      committee before the firefighter's death, to receive death benefits which
24      may be payable under the retirement system;
25            (4) Funding agent means any bank, trust company, life insurance
26      company, thrift institution, credit union, or investment management firm
27      selected by the retirement committee, subject to the approval of the
28      city, to hold or invest the funds of the retirement system;
29            (5) Regular interest means the rate of interest earned each calendar
30      year commencing January 1, 1984, equal to the rate of net earnings
31      realized for the calendar year from investments of the retirement fund.

 1      Net earnings means the amount by which income or gain realized from
  2     investments of the retirement fund exceeds the amount of any realized
  3     losses from such investments during the calendar year. The retirement
  4     committee shall annually report the amount of regular interest earned for
  5     such year;
 6             (6) Regular pay means the salary of a firefighter at the date such
 7      firefighter elects to retire or terminate employment with the city;
  8            (7)    Retirement committee means the retirement committee created
  9     pursuant to section 16-1034;
10             (8) Retirement system means a retirement system established pursuant
11      to sections 16-1020 to 16-1042;
 12            (9)     Retirement value means the accumulated value of     the
 13     firefighter's employee account and employer account. The retirement value
 14     at any time shall consist of    the sum of     the contributions made or
 15     transferred to such accounts by the firefighter and by the city on the
 16     firefighter's behalf and the regular interest credited to the accounts
 17     through such date, reduced by any realized losses which were not taken
 18     into account in determining regular interest in any year, and as further
 19     adjusted each year to     reflect the accounts'           pro rata share of     the
 20     appreciation or depreciation of the assets of the retirement system as
21      determined by    the retirement committee at     their fair market values,
 22     including any account under subsection         (2)    of section       16-1036.       Such
 23     valuation shall be undertaken at least annually as of December 31 of each
24      year and at     such other times as    may be    directed by     the retirement
25      committee. The value of each account shall be reduced each year by the
26      appropriate share of    the investment costs as     provided in   section
27      16-1036.01. The retirement value shall be further reduced by the amount
28      of all distributions made to or on the behalf of the firefighter from the
29      retirement system;
 30            (10) Salary means all amounts paid to a participating firefighter by
31      the employing city for personal services the base rate of pay, excluding

  1     overtime, callback pay, clothing allowances, and other such benefits as
  2     reported on the participant's federal income tax withholding statement,
 3      including the firefighters'    contributions picked up   by the city as
 4      provided in subsection (2) of section 16-1024 and any salary reduction
  5     contributions which are excludable from income for federal income tax
  6     purposes pursuant to section 125 or 457 of the Internal Revenue Code;
 7          (11) Sex-neutral basis means the benefit calculation provided to the
 8      city of the first class by a licensed domestic or foreign insurance or
 9      annuity company with a product available for purchase in Nebraska that
10      utilizes a blended, non-gender-specific rate for actuarial assumptions,
 11     mortality assumptions, and annuity conversion rates for a particular
12      participant, except that if a blended, non-gender-specific rate is not
13      available for purchase in Nebraska, the benefit calculation shall be
14      performed using the arithmetic mean of   the male-specific actuarial
15      assumptions, mortality assumptions, or annuity conversion rates and the
16      female-specific actuarial assumptions, mortality assumptions, or annuity
17      conversion rates, as applicable, for a particular participant, and the
18      arithmetic mean shall be determined by adding the male-specific actuarial
19      assumptions, mortality assumptions, or annuity conversion rates to the
20      female-specific actuarial assumptions, mortality assumptions, or annuity
21      conversion rates applicable to a particular participant and dividing the
22      sum by two; and
23          (12) Straight life annuity means an ordinary annuity payable for the
 24     life of the primary annuitant only, and terminating at his or her death
 25     without refund or death benefit of any kind.
26          Sec.    2.      Original section    16-1021,    Reissue Revised Statutes of
27      Nebraska, is repealed.
